Description

The Lactation Consultant RN is a registered professional nurse who supports breastfeeding patients, collaborates with interdisciplinary teams, teaches nursing techniques, develops nursing care procedures, and maintains ANA standards of practice. The position applies evidence-based practice, integrates research, and focuses on patient-centered outcomes.

Responsibilities
  • A clinically competent registered nurse who evaluates and improves nursing care for breastfeeding patients.
  • Consults with nursing, medical staff, and other disciplines to achieve this goal.
  • Teaches and demonstrates specific nursing care techniques related to breastfeeding patients.
  • Assists in the development of nursing care procedures for breastfeeding patients.
  • Effectively interacts with patients, significant others, and health team members while maintaining ANA standards of professional nursing practice.
  • Collects comprehensive assessment data pertinent to the patient's health or situation.
  • Analyzes assessment data to determine diagnosis or issues.
  • Identifies expected outcomes for individualized plans.
  • Develops a plan prescribing strategies or alternatives to attain expected outcomes.
  • Implements the identified plan, coordinates care delivery, and employs education strategies to promote health and safe environment.
  • Evaluates progress toward outcomes.
  • Collaborates with patients, family, and others in nursing practice.
  • Creates a documented plan focused on outcomes and decisions related to care delivery.
  • Considers safety, effectiveness, cost, and impact on practice when choosing options for expected outcome.
  • Integrates research findings into practice and utilizes best available evidence to guide practice decisions.
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or of Nursing.
  • Registered Nurse in the State of Illinois.
  • CPR—Basic Life Support certification.
  • Certification by the International Board of Lactation Consultants (IBCLC).
  • Current experience within the past five years or new nursing graduate within the past two years.
Preferred Qualifications
  • One year experience in a pertinent clinical specialty.
